The Kyrenia District Region

Kyrenia with its Byzantine harbour & Castle, is beautiful to vist daytime or evening. The little horseshoe harbour is surrounded by cafes & bars housed in the old carob Houses. Daily boat trips can be taken around the coast from here. Bellapais Abbey built around 1200 is a beautiful old monastery, there are sometimes Classical Concerts held there & the views from the village there are amazing. St Hilarion Castle is also worth a visit. It is named after a saint who escaped from Jerusalem in the 10th century, there are lots of steps up to it, but it is worth it for the view. The climate of Cyprus is lovely. March. April, May, June, Sept, October & even November are around 20-25c & there is usually a breeze. July & August are for the sunworhippers when the temperature reaches 30-35c, but it is always cooler on the beaches.

A 15-20 drive takes you to Turtle Beach which is a conservation area for hatching Turtles. In June & July visitors are encouraged to come in the evenings to watch the hatchings, an unforgettale experience.It is also a lovely place to spend the day, but it has no sunbeds for hire, just miles of sand & few people.
If hiring a car it is worthwhile to visit Famagusta, have a drink at the Palm Beach Hotel there & have a look at the old city of Varosha, The no mans land since 1974 when the division of the Island took place. It is still patrolled by the UN & no-one is allowed to enter but it can be viewed through the wire, fascinating. The Salamis Ruins which are an ancient Roman town are close to Famagusta, tourists can visit them for a few Lira.The Karpas which is known as the panhandle is a must see as well.If you drive to the very tip you can visit St Andreas monastery which is still a Greek Church. The area has lovely unspoilt beaches & wild donkeys. you can drive for miles & not see another car.Take a picnic if you go there as there are few cafes.
There are 2 Golf courses about an hours drive away. There is a brown course at Guzelyurt on the West of the Island & a brand new one at Esentepe in the East. Both accept visitors.
